You should plan your garden well in advance if you want to create a family garden. It is important to determine how much sun you have at your house. Before you plant, ensure that your soil is in good shape. There are battery operated timers available at hardware stores that will help you water your plants. Automated irrigation systems are also an option, especially for humid regions.
Landscapers are skilled at both biology and design. When you plant a garden, you need to know what plants will grow well in the area and where to plant them. You will need to ensure that your vegetables get plenty of sun. Consider adding deer-proof fencing to your fence.
The best landscapers also have an artistic eye. To prevent deer eating your fruit and vegetables, you might want to put up a fence if you're planting a garden. If you grow a vegetable yard, it is important to discuss nutrition, color, and texture.

Planning a family garden requires that you have plenty of sun. If you're growing vegetables, you'll need at least eight hours of full sun each day.

Why is family gardening important
Family gardeners love to grow food for their family.
Family gardens allow children to learn responsibility while developing patience, cooperation, time management, and problem-solving skills. In addition to helping parents grow their self-esteem, gardening also teaches them how they can care for the environment.
Adults who are more connected to nature through gardens can feel less stressed and may have better health. When we spend time outdoors, our brains release chemicals called "happy hormones" that make us happier and healthier.
Family gardening offers many benefits beyond the physical and psychological health. Gardens help to conserve natural resources, preserve the environment, reduce stormwater runoff, filter pollutants, and create habitats for wildlife.
